Locel, short for "low cell," is text indicating low battery level that used to be displayed on phone pagers, back when those were a thing. The letters were chosen because they can be depicted on seven-segment LED displays, which are primarily designed for showing numbers, and the letters were shown in all caps, e.g. "LO CELL". When used as a slang term, "locel" or "low cell" indicates someone is tired or out of energy, and is a nod to the 90s.
